A bricklayer could lay 500 standard bricks in a typical eight-hour day. It implies that 500 bricks can be laid if there are no accessibility issues like the need for scaffolding.
Due to the numerous variables (block size and weight, number of corners and returns to construct, etc.), the final number might be anywhere from 100 to 150.
